    Part of the problem, unfortunately, is it's never on TV. Not in the US.


    Spike TV carries MMA which appeals to the same people boxing would if it were free.
    Kids see boxers as one dimensional and don't realize how much skill and toughness boxing requires. All they know is boxers would get beat in MMA cause that is all they know.

    I've done a little of everything...enough to know boxing was the hardest thing I ever tried.


    The scumbags have taken the pure sweet science (unfortunately) away from the masses to view.

    They must bring it back to the little people.....I think in five years revenues would skyrocket if they did.
